[책] 자바스크립트 코드 레시피 278 - 236일차

wangkodok·2022년 10월 20일
0

처리 파일 분할하기

  • 처리에 따라 파이를 분할하고 싶을 때

설명

ES 모듈은 여러 자바스크립트의 파일을 의존 관계에 따라 불러오는 작업을 합니다. 규모가 큰 프로그램이 하나의 자바스크립트 파일만을 사용하게 되면 기능별 구조의 파악과 분류가 복잡하고 어려워 버그의 원인이 되기도 합니다.

실습

ES 모듈의 사용은 HTML script 태그에 type="module" 속성을 사용합니다.

name.js

export class Name {
  myName() {
    return '개발자';
  }
}

age.js

export class Age {
  myAge() {
    return 30;
  }
}

main.js

import { Name } from "name.js";
import { Age } from "age.js";

console.log( new Name().myName() );
console.log( new Age().myAge() );
profile
기술을 기록하다.

0개의 댓글

관련 채용 정보